Israel Eliminated An Iranian Commander Responsible For Launching Drones

The IDF revealed the details.

On June 20, the Israel Defense Forces eliminated an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ps (IRGC) commander responsible for drone launches.

It was reported by the IDF press office.

"Yesterday, the Israeli Air Force struck and eliminated Aminpour Judaki, commander of the IRGC Air Force's Second UAV Brigade," the Israeli military said.

According to the IDF, Judaki organized drone launches toward the State of Israel from the Ahvaz region in southwestern Iran.

"Judaki assumed a key role in operations following the elimination of IRGC Air Force Commander Taher Fur on June 13, 2025," the IDF added.
